What OS are you using? No NPE's for Windows 7.

NPE's may be caused by not having the classes in RAM, increased permgen fixes that.

NPE's may be caused by not having a large enough heap to give you a pointer, because you choked Hexxit's -xmx/max memory down.

(Windows 7)

Launcher: 1.5GB with increased PermGen.

Server: java -Xmx3G -Xms2G -XX:MaxPermSize=256M -Xincgc -jar Hexxit.jar nogui

-Xincgc is an incremental garbage collector, I'm hoping it smooths the frame rate for combat

I have the server on the same machine I connect from.

I also set B:useSimpleEntityClassnames=true to cut this out.
